.wp-block-custom-blocks-buttons-child,.buttons-block-child--primary,.buttons-block-child--effect{margin-top:0;margin-bottom:0;width:fit-content;position:relative}.wp-block-custom-blocks-buttons-child .buttons-block-child-content,.buttons-block-child--primary .buttons-block-child-content,.buttons-block-child--effect .buttons-block-child-content{color:#fff;text-decoration:none;padding:.8em 1.4em;background-color:#005a2d;border-radius:6px;border:1px solid #005a2d;display:flex;align-items:center;gap:1rem;transition:all .3s ease}.wp-block-custom-blocks-buttons-child .buttons-block-child-content:hover,.buttons-block-child--primary .buttons-block-child-content:hover,.buttons-block-child--effect .buttons-block-child-content:hover{background-color:#007b3d}.wp-block-custom-blocks-buttons-child .buttons-block-child-content span,.buttons-block-child--primary .buttons-block-child-content span,.buttons-block-child--effect .buttons-block-child-content span{color:#fff;font-weight:700;font-family:"Roboto Mono",monospace;font-size:.9rem}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-text-input .components-base-control__field,.buttons-block-child--primary .buttons-block-child-content .button-text-input .components-base-control__field,.buttons-block-child--effect .buttons-block-child-content .button-text-input .components-base-control__field{margin:0}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input,.buttons-block-child--primary .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input,.buttons-block-child--effect .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input{border:none;background:rgba(0,0,0,0);padding:0;margin:0;outline:none;min-width:50px;text-align:center;width:auto;field-sizing:content;box-shadow:none;border-radius:0;height:auto;min-height:0;color:#fff;font-weight:700;font-family:"Roboto Mono",monospace;font-size:.9rem}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input::placeholder,.buttons-block-child--primary .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input::placeholder,.buttons-block-child--effect .buttons-block-child-content .button-text-input .components-base-control__field .components-text-control__input::placeholder{color:hsla(0,0%,100%,.7)}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-icon,.buttons-block-child--primary .buttons-block-child-content .button-icon,.buttons-block-child--effect .buttons-block-child-content .button-icon{width:16px;height:16px;flex-shrink:0}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-icon svg,.buttons-block-child--primary .buttons-block-child-content .button-icon svg,.buttons-block-child--effect .buttons-block-child-content .button-icon svg{width:100%;height:100%;display:block}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-icon svg path,.buttons-block-child--primary .buttons-block-child-content .button-icon svg path,.buttons-block-child--effect .buttons-block-child-content .button-icon svg path{fill:#fff;color:#fff}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-icon-left,.buttons-block-child--primary .buttons-block-child-content .button-icon-left,.buttons-block-child--effect .buttons-block-child-content .button-icon-left{order:-1}.wp-block-custom-blocks-buttons-child .buttons-block-child-content .button-icon-right,.buttons-block-child--primary .buttons-block-child-content .button-icon-right,.buttons-block-child--effect .buttons-block-child-content .button-icon-right{order:1}.buttons-block-child--effect .buttons-block-child-content{background-color:#b8552f;border:1px solid #b8552f}.buttons-block-child--effect .buttons-block-child-content .button-icon svg path{fill:#fff;color:#fff}.buttons-block-child--effect .buttons-block-child-content:hover{background-color:#d1613f}
